A radiant talent on the brink of making it big in Nashville
must confront her small-town past and an old love she’s
never forgotten in this engaging novel—a soulful ballad
filled with romance, heartbreak, secrets, and scandal from
the author of Season of the Dragonflies. Playing to packed houses while her hit song rushes up the
charts, country singer and fiddler Jo Lover is poised to
become a one-name Nashville star like her idols, Loretta,
Reba, and Dolly. To ensure her success, Jo has carefully
crafted her image: a pretty, sassy, down-to-earth girl from
small-town Virginia who pours her heart into her songs. But the stage persona she’s built is threatened when her
independent label merges with big-time Capitol Records,
bringing Nashville heartthrob JD Gunn—her first love—back
into her life. Long ago Jo played with JD’s band. But they
parted ways, and took their own crooked roads to stardom.
Now Jo’s excited—and terrified—to see him again. When the label reunites them for a show, the old sparks fly,
the duet they sing goes viral, and fans begin clamoring for
more—igniting the media’s interest in the compelling singer.
Why is a small-town girl like Jo so quiet about her past?
When did she and JD first meet? What split them apart? All
too soon, the painful secret she’s been hiding is uncovered,
a shocking revelation that threatens to destroy her
reputation and her dreams. To salvage her life and her
career, Jo must finally face the past—and her feelings for
JD—to become the true Nashville diva she was meant to be.
